Job Title: Clinical Nurse Orthopedics

At BJC, we're committed to providing exceptional patient care and promoting a culture of excellence. As a Clinical Nurse Orthopedics, you'll play a vital role in delivering high-quality care to our patients.

Job Summary:

We're seeking a skilled and compassionate Clinical Nurse Orthopedics to join our team. In this role, you'll provide direct patient care, assess patient needs, and develop individualized plans of care. You'll work collaboratively with our interdisciplinary team to ensure seamless care transitions and promote patient safety and quality outcomes.

Responsibilities:
  • Provide direct patient care, including assessment, diagnosis, planning, implementation, and evaluation
  • Develop and implement individualized plans of care in collaboration with the interprofessional team
  • Assess patient preferences and barriers to involvement in care, including their values, emotional, spiritual, cultural, and population-specific needs
  • Participate in activities that promote patient safety, quality, and regulatory compliance
  • Participate in professional development and education
Requirements:
  • Nursing Diploma/Associate's degree in Nursing
  • No experience required
  • RN licensure
Preferred Requirements:
  • Bachelor's degree in Nursing
  • Ortho experience
Benefits:

At BJC, we offer a comprehensive benefits package, including medical, dental, vision, life insurance, and legal services. We also offer a pension plan, 401(k) plan with BJC match, tuition assistance, and paid time off.
